แถบเครื่องมือนักพัฒนา: Command line interface สารพัดประโยชน์บน Firefox

แถบเครื่องมือนักพัฒนาหรือชื่อในภาษาอังกฤษว่า Developer Toolbar เป็นแถบเครื่องมือเล็ก ๆ ที่อยู่ล่างสุดของหน้าต่าง Firefox เวลาเปิดใช้งานก็แค่กด Shift + F2 แต่ความสามารถของเจ้าตัวนี้ไม่ค่อยเล็กเลย เพราะเราใส่สามารถใส่ graphical command line interface ลงไปได้ ถูกใจนักพัฒนาสาย terminal หรือ linux มาก ๆ

เริ่มแรก อยากรู้อะไรก็แค่พิมพ์ help ก็จะปรากฏรายการที่เราสามารถพิมพ์คำสั่งลงไปได้ยาวพรืดแบบนี้

ส่วนตัวแล้วมีคำสั่งโปรดที่ใช้ประจำ ๆ ก็มี

  • restart: เวลา Firefox เริ่มอืด (ใช้เกิน 6 ชม.) ก็พิมพ์แค่คำสั่งนี้มันก็จะทำการเริ่ม Firefox ใหม่ให้อัตโนมัติ
  • screenshot: จับภาพหน้าจอ (screenshot) ภายใน Firefox ได้เองโดยไม่ต้องพึ่งพาโปรแกรมภายนอก แถมมีคำสั่ง –fullpage จับภาพทั้งเว็บได้ด้วย แม้เว็บจะยาวแค่ไหนก็ยังจับได้
    ตัวอย่างคำสั่ง screenshot screenshot_wiki.png –fullpage
  • jsb: ย่อมาจาก JavaScript beautifier ก็ตรงตัวเลยว่าทำให้ไฟล์ js ที่ถูกบีบอัดขนาดและตัวแปร (minimisation) แปลงและจัดระเบียบให้อ่านออก (beautifier) อีกครั้ง เหมาะสำหรับการ debug โค้ด javascript เป็นอย่างยิ่ง
    ตัวอย่างคำสั่ง jsb http://code.jquery.com/jquery-2.0.2.min.js
  • export: ณ ตอนนี้สามารถนำออกมาได้เป็น html อย่างเดียว โดยมันจะทำการคัดลอก source code html แล้วเปิดอีกแท็บนึงที่เป็นตัวอักษรล้วน ๆ (plain text) สามารถคัดลอกหรือบันทึกไฟล์ (.txt) ลงไปได้เลย
    ตัวอย่างคำสั่ง export html

ยังมีอีกหลายคำสั่งรอไปศึกษาเอาจาก help ดูครับ ถ้าอยากได้คำสั่งเอาไว้ใช้เองก็สามารถเขียนเองได้ด้วย A ‘mozcmd’ directory หรือใช้ The Scratchpad ก็ได้เช่นกัน ลองใช้แถบเครื่องมือนักพัฒนาดูครับ ง่ายและเร็วกว่าการจับเมาส์เป็นไหน ๆ

No responses yet

Post a comment

ส่งความคิดเห็น